Like FieldGrade said your intended purpose should dictate your scope selection. My current 222 wears a 6.5-20x40mm and is used for colony varmints, and targets, small targets big scope. My last 222 wears a 1-3x20mm, it was on an O/U combo gun used for coyote hunting, larger targets. In the hands of a new owner it accounted for two turkeys and six coyotes this spring so it seems to be about perfect for the intended use also.

Smaller power scope usually have a larger FOV which works well for called coyotes and are more than accurate enough for coyotes out to the effective range of a 222.
